BG2
1)If you're saying is it better to stick soley to the game storyline without venturing out to Windspear, De'Arnise Keep and so forth, I wouldn't say so. Doing those quests give you a lot of experience, gold, and very good items.
2)Depends what class you are. Tepicly, if you have a fighter, you get to add a star to one of your weapon profiencies every 2 to 3 levels, it's different for most classes.

For some good amounts of gold, I suggest doing Renal Bloodscalp's Shadow Thief Quest in the docks, go through the de'Arnise Keep, or you can go to Mae'Var's Guildhall. Reason I say this, is because you can buy an infinite amount of maces +2 and sell them back for a higher amount of gold than what you paid for them.
